Quote from @Wayne Brooks:
@Kyle Keller Yeah, somebody is spouting delusions....
-a QCD has no effect on liens whatsoever.
-a foreclosure action by a first mtg in itself extinguishes any junior liens, no qcd necessary, even If it did do anything.
More information said the idea was to extinguish the junior lien position. A lot of people have called fraud, seems like not a good path to go down.

@Stephen Keighery It's a different way of planning. Instead of planning out for a 12-month year and evaluating every quarter how you're doing and setting goals for the entire year, you condense the year down to 12 weeks and set goals for the 12 weeks, and reevaluate every week how you're doing. The big thing with it is a weekly accountability meeting - a WAM. My WAM is excellent; I would like to meet with more investing-focused people.
